Output 89e686e7caceb55f350290a055c12be8d196c817d5df8b608634a9ff8e38d25a:0

value
142025280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ccc9ade456713515b4599e691d472ec58d330ee3 OP_EQUAL
address
MSZygV4WG3KgKAKzo3VMrUhaEuXdLxUMPp
transaction
89e686e7caceb55f350290a055c12be8d196c817d5df8b608634a9ff8e38d25a
spent
true